Attached program:
template <bool...> struct bool_sequence {};
template <class T, class...Us>
concept bool Same =
__is_same_as(bool_sequence<__is_same_as(T, Us)...>,
bool_sequence<(true || __is_same_as(T, Us))...>);
template <class I>
concept bool A =
requires (I& i) {
requires Same<I&, decltype(++i)>;
};
template <class I>
concept bool B = A<I> && true;
template <A>
constexpr bool f() { return false; }
template <B>
constexpr bool f() { return true; }
int main() {
static_assert(f<int>());
}
ICEs with:
~/concept-gcc/bin/g++ -std=gnu++1z foo2.cpp -c
foo2.cpp: In function ‘int main()’:
foo2.cpp:23:24: internal compiler error: canonical types differ for identical
types bool_sequence<__is_same_as(I&, decltype(++*i))> and
bool_sequence<__is_same_as(I&, decltype(++*i))>
static_assert(f<int>());
^
